Greg Smith wrote:
> Next up is "Start/stop archiving at runtime". First set of questions:
>
> -Is this referring to the current PITR archiving as done via
> archive_command, does it intend to cover a wider scope than that, or is
> "archiving" being used in a general replication sense instead not
> related to that?
>
> -What is the issue with Skype and failed nodes this is alluding to?
>

AFAIK the only issue is that we cannot set archive_mode without restarting
Postgres. This leads to archive_mode always set to "on" and a dummy
archive_command being used. The background for this is that we don't know
in advance when we need to create a PITR clone of a particular database.
